DDS-Format OAT Drive Configuration- C1503B and C1504B
Caution
'
Note
Options
The drive configuration is set for the system it is installed in. Changing the
configuration may cause the drive to malfunction.
Devices installed outside the system will be configured differently.
All of the configuration information for the C1504B 3.5-inch DAT drive is the
same as that for the C1503B 3.5-inch DAT drive
The drive configuration is set with jumpers on the option connector (see Figure 4-12). A
pin-set is shorted with a jumper installed, or open without a jumper.
SCSI Address
Note
~
.
Some drives inchide an address cable that is connected to the SCSI Address
pin-sets .
~
~
On drives that do not include an address cable, the SCSI address is set using jumpers.
Figure 4-12 shows jumper settings for SCSI address 0 through 7. Avoid using address 7. It is
usually reserved for the host busrdapter (HBA).
